Purchasing the Correct Golf Equipment
When you begin playing golf you will realize very quickly
that there is some very specific equipment you will need. Here
are some obvious and not so obvious equipment needs and how to
pick the best for you and your game.
You will definitely need golf balls. If you have ever wondered
why they are dimpled, it is so that they can travel farther by
cutting down on the air drag. All golf balls come with the
standard dimples in them and some might have slight variations
with the materials used on the inside, however most are
exactly the same and only the brand name is different.

Also, when buying your clubs they come individually and in
sets. If you are just starting out then purchasing a set will
work because it will have each type of club you will need in
it. As you become better than buying individual clubs becomes
more practical as your needs change.
There are also golf club covers for the heads of your clubs.
These are usually soft and protect the golf club heads from
damage. Dents or scratches can ruin your aim and drive shots,
so keeping the heads protected even when they are in a bag is
still important.
Next, there is the golf bag to hold all your clubs and balls
along with many other items that become essential while on the
golf course. Many bags have a small cooler attached so you
keep water and other drinks cold. They usually have a few
pockets for tees, balls, and towels. Some will have enough
room for an extra shirt or two and another pair of shoes. You
will want to get one that is made well so it does not tear and
fall apart from all the weight you have placed in it. However,
it should be light when empty so you are not lugging around
extra weight of the bag too.
Make sure you have a good pair of golf shoes too. They are not
the same as regular shoes and our made specifically for the
sport and the terrain you will be playing on. They have rubber
spikes on the bottom to help grip the ground while you are
playing. You want to have sure footing while playing and golf
shoes make sure that happens. Make sure they fit well and our
comfortable like any other shoe, since you will be doing a lot
of walking in them as well.
You can buy tees or the golf course many times will provide
them for you. It is a small usually wooden pin with a larger
flat top to set your ball on to tee off.
